On October 31st, Edgemont Village organized a Halloween event. The streets were filled with excited children dressed in an array of spooky and fun costumes, eagerly going from door to door, collecting their sweet rewards. 

Rev. Sharon, and Marymil together with Ashkon who dressed up as Santa Claus. set up a booth adorned with bowls of treats, cute scarecrows and lanterns glowing ominously on the sidewalk in front of the church. The moon shone brightly overhead, casting a mystical glow on the festivities below.

Children, accompanied by their guardian visited the booth and joyfully shout the famous phrase, "Trick or Treat!" Dogs were there, too, to say hi. 

The community spirit was palpable as neighbors greeted each other, exchanging compliments on costumes and sharing stories of past Halloweens. It was a night where strangers became friends, brought together by the joy of the occasion.

Trick or Treats was indeed successful, bringing joy, laughter, and a sense of community to all who participated.
